Chris Koster was sworn in as Missouri’s 41st Attorney General on January 12th, 2009. Since becoming Attorney General, Koster has focused efforts on detecting and prosecuting Medicaid fraud, pursuing mortgage-relief and debt-settlement scams, cracking down on fraudulent auto service contract businesses, using Missouri’s legal authority to protect our water resources, and educating public officials about their obligations under Missouri’s Sunshine Law.
Prior to being elected Attorney General, Mr. Koster served in the Missouri Senate from 2004 to 2008, representing Cass, Johnson, Bates, and Vernon counties. He previously served as Cass County Prosecuting Attorney for ten years.
Mr. Koster was born and raised in St. Louis. He is a graduate of the University of Missouri and the University of Missouri School of Law. He also earned a Masters in Business Administration from Washington University in St. Louis.
